On 19 and 20 May 2026, a Peer Review of the railway accident safety investigation function of the Transport Accident and Incident Investigation Bureau (hereinafter – TAIIB) was carried out in Latvia. It was organised within the framework of the common Peer Review programme of the European Network of National Investigation Bodies in accordance with the requirements of Article 22 of Directive (EU) 2016/798 on railway safety.
The assessment was carried out by experts from the national investigation bodies of Romania, the Czech Republic and Germany. Representatives of the European Union Agency for Railways and investigation bodies from other countries also participated in the process as observers.
During the Peer Review, the legal framework governing TAIIB’s activities and its institutional independence were assessed, together with the organisation of investigation work, available resources and staff competence, accident notification and decision-making procedures, practices for collecting and analysing evidence, preparation of investigation reports, monitoring of safety recommendations, as well as investigator training and occupational safety.
The expert panel concluded that TAIIB effectively performs the functions assigned to it by legislation, operates in practice with a high degree of independence, and produces high-quality investigation reports and safety recommendations. Particular strengths identified included the accident notification system, the ability to respond promptly and attend accident sites, the quality of investigation reports, cooperation between the Bureau’s departments, professional development opportunities for investigators, and the initiation of a thematic investigation into accidents at railway level crossings.
At the same time, the experts recommended improving the legal framework by establishing more specific criteria for the appointment and dismissal of the head of TAIIB, as well as considering the recruitment of a permanent human factors specialist who could support safety investigations across all modes of transport.
